Using expert evidence to determine whether a trust is a sham

By Suzana Popovic-Montag ( December 11, 2025, 12:02 PM EST) -- When issues arise in litigation that involve specialized knowledge, technical expertise or scientific understanding, it is relatively common for the parties to submit expert evidence to assist the court with making its determinations. Expert evidence may be admissible on a wide range of issues — even specialized legal issues — so long as the evidence is proffered by a properly qualified expert, is relevant and necessary, and is not barred by an exclusionary rule....
